Sony Xperia Z3 and Xperia Z3 Compact screenshots, specifications surface

Sony Xperia Z3 and Z3 Compact screenshot leak

Sony unveiled the Xperia Z1 Compact and the Xperia Z2 earlier this year. Now alleged screenshots from the Xperia Z3 and the Xperia Z3 Compact has surfaced online. The Xperia Z3 screenshot shows the model number D6653 and the model number of the Z3 Compact is D58XX (D5833 likely). Both the screenshots confirm Snapdragon 801 MSM8974-AC chipset and run on Android 4.4 KitKat. LG G3 Prime with Snapdragon 805 UA Profile shows up, passes Bluetooth Certification

LG Electronics

LG G3 Prime, an enhanced variant of the LG G3 has been rumored to be in the works for quite sometime now. UA Profile of the LG smartphone with the model number LG-F460L and codenamed Tiger has surfaced online that shows APQ8084, Qualcomm Snapdragon 805 SoC onboard. The LG-F460L that ends in L is expected to head to Korean operator LGU+. The LG-F460S, another variant that is expected to head to SK Telecom (SKT) has passed Bluetooth certification. Samsung Galaxy Mega 2 specs revealed in benchmarks

Reports about Samsung working on the Galaxy Mega successor had surfaced online few months back. Today, specifications about the phablet has been spotted on GFX Benchmark database. The device which has a model number SM-G7508 boasts of a 5.9 inch screen with 1280 x 720 resolution.

Acer Chromebook CB5 powered by Tegra K1 surfaces

Acer’s latest Chromebook CB5 has been leaked online by a Swedish retailer. The CB5 features a 13.3-inch HD screen and is powered by a powerful Nvidia Tegra K1 CPU rather than a traditional Intel-based chip, according to a website’s listing.
